When Jackie Chan came to Falls Creek and 'got hypothermia' in a frozen lake

The article recounts the filming of Jackie Chan's 1995 movie 'First Strike' at Falls Creek in Australia, highlighting the challenges faced by the cast and crew. The production team sought the alpine resort for its snowy landscape, similar to Eastern Europe, and enlisted local skier Steve Lee for stunt work. Despite initial reluctance due to financial concerns, Lee eventually participated in some scenes. Jackie Chan performed several dangerous stunts, including a scene where he spent 30 minutes in a frozen lake without a wetsuit, leading to hypothermia. Director Stanley Tong also took on risky stunts, such as a high jump from a helicopter into a frozen lake. The piece emphasizes the physical demands and dedication of both Chan and Tong during the filming.
